ANIMAL WATCH-On January 27, Los Angeles County Sheriff's Bloodsport Team seized 70 roosters in an investigation of a possible cockfighting operation in LLanos, California, an unincorporated area southeast of Palmdale in Los Angeles County. Detective Joel Bronson told reporters that suspects were identified but no arrests made, pending the outcome of the examination of the birds by LA County Animal Control veterinarians, according to the Los Angeles Times. "The sheriff's department typically launches investigations based on complaints about noise and sanitation from neighbors," according to Detective Bronson, who added that, "Prior to coronavirus restrictions making it harder to raid suspected cockfighting operations, sheriff’s officials typically executed a search warrant every month or two."
